NC machines used commands that have been manually entered onto punch playing cards and fed into the machines to direct them to accomplish particular manufacturing duties. By using servomechanisms to sense the tool’s place in house, NC machines were capable of produce goods more exactly. The Second World War’s army wants pushed corporations supplying the united states Air Force to seek increasingly efficient methods of NC to produce standardized airplanes and weapons with unparalleled precision. Up till the mid-1950s, NC expertise was adopted by several industrial outfits past the army suppliers. Because of the perceived economic advantages of automating machine tooling, NC was quickly hailed as the innovation of the final decade in manufacturing, permitting corporations to chop workforce costs and enhance high quality.

Once the CNC program has been posted, it can be downloaded to the machine tool every time the production schedule requires it. Posting is a one-time commitment to a selected revision for a specific machine tool. If the posted CNC program produces a nest of components, it'll produce the identical quantity of parts every time it is run. If a special amount of components is required for the following manufacturing cycle, the CNC program will need to be reposted, but may use the same geometry. Posting a program is the process of translating this interim geometry-based plan into a selected machine device management program.
